

IBM Spectrum Computing and CloudSphere are competing products in IT infrastructure management and optimization. IBM Spectrum Computing appears to have an advantage in integrating with existing enterprise systems, while CloudSphere is preferred for its comprehensive cloud management solutions offering scalability and flexibility, making it ideal for cloud-focused businesses.
Features: IBM Spectrum Computing's key features include handling complex data workloads, advanced analytics, and seamless integration with enterprise environments. CloudSphere highlights robust cloud governance, application discovery tools, and comprehensive multi-cloud management capabilities.
Room for Improvement: IBM Spectrum Computing may need to simplify its complex systems and improve user-friendliness to better accommodate users not requiring high computing power. Enhancing support for non-enterprise environment integration could also be beneficial. For CloudSphere, further optimization to handle high-demand server tasks and reductions in latency or error rates would increase reliability. Simplifying the monitoring features and adding more native support for on-premise solutions could enhance its efficiency.
Ease of Deployment and Customer Service: IBM Spectrum Computing's deployment is favorable for enterprises with existing infrastructure, offering strong support for integration and setup. CloudSphere provides a straightforward cloud-centric deployment model with cloud migration support, streamlining the transition to cloud environments, with efficient customer support for quick assistance.
Pricing and ROI: IBM Spectrum Computing may carry a higher initial setup cost, justified by integration capabilities and extensive computational features, offering a strong ROI for enterprises with substantial data workloads. CloudSphere tends to present a more cost-effective setup, providing favorable ROI through lower operational costs and enhanced cloud cost management.

CloudSphere offers a unique multi-cloud management solution with features like attack path analysis, cost management, and predictive insights designed to enhance infrastructure reliability.
Providing an agent-less SaaS-based discovery tool, CloudSphere simplifies multi-cloud management with its single-pane interface, ensuring seamless data access in hybrid cloud environments. Its predictive insights and improved infrastructure reliability are valuable for both development and operational teams. However, it could improve in application management, real-time monitoring, and resource migration across clouds. Issues like inefficient large server scans and limitations in CI/CD integration and application discovery can be hindrances for some users.
What are CloudSphere's key features?CloudSphere is widely used in DevOps to manage test development networks, monitor application behaviors, and assess risk levels. Ideal for those managing inventories across public clouds, it's found in hyper-converged infrastructures in industries like healthcare, supporting hospital management and integrated services.
IBM Spectrum Computing offers robust data backup and resource management capabilities, enhancing workload management and analytics for efficient data centers.
IBM Spectrum Computing is renowned for its backup capabilities and policy-driven resource management. It's used to cluster compute resources effectively and manage workloads efficiently. It supports data centers with intelligent workload management and predictive analytics, delivering speed and robustness. The ability to handle both VTL and tape with reliable technical support is a key advantage, although challenges include reliability issues, fragmented support, and compatibility concerns, particularly with Nutanix.
What are IBM Spectrum Computing's key features?IBM Spectrum Computing is implemented primarily for on-premises data backup and storage across industries safeguarding VMware, Hyper-V, and UNIX environments. It supports applications such as batch and on-demand processing, HPC, file servers, databases, ETL activities, Kubernetes, and mainframe operations, ensuring resilience and security.
